Anantnag Police Attaches 08 Vehicles Worth ₹20 Lakh Under NDPS Act

Anantnag, May 14 (KNC): Continuing its intensified crackdown against drug trafficking and narcotics networks, Jammu and Kashmir Police in Anantnag has attached eight vehicles worth nearly ₹20 lakh under the provisions of Section 68-E of the NDPS Act.

 

Police said the action was carried out by Police Station Anantnag as part of its ongoing campaign to dismantle the financial infrastructure of drug peddlers and curb the menace of narcotics in the district.

 

The attached vehicles include two Magic vehicles, one passenger auto-rickshaw, one WagonR car, one Bolero vehicle and three motorcycles. During investigation, these vehicles were identified as assets either acquired through proceeds of drug trafficking or used in connection with illegal narcotics activities.

 

Officials said the total market value of the attached property is estimated at around ₹20 lakh.

 

Anantnag Police stated that the drive against narcotics will continue with full force and warned individuals involved in drug peddling that strict legal action, including attachment of illegally acquired properties, will be taken against them.

 

Police reiterated its commitment to making Anantnag a drug-free district and urged the public to cooperate in the fight against the drug menace.(KNC)
